Job Summary:

Overview:

Disney CreativeWorks (DCW) Studio is a full-service branded content studio and creative agency with global scale, proprietary insights and data, unparalleled access to the world's most valuable IP, and a legacy of captivating clients and audiences everywhere. We are responsible for creative, strategy, and production of custom branded entertainment and sponsored content solutions across all Disney Entertainment platforms and channels - Hulu, Disney+, ABC, FX, National Geographic, Freeform, Disney Channels, and Disney Branded Television.

As an Associate Producer, you will be responsible for contributing to the daily production of turn-key co-branded assets for use in sponsorship campaigns featuring Disney Entertainment scripted, unscripted, franchise, and major content packages across multiple brands and platforms.

You will oversee assigned productions from initial proposal through to production and delivery. This includes developing production timelines, securing client or internal assets, coordinating with internal editor and GFX teams or liaising with external production vendors, and collaborating with ad operations to ensure flawless delivery. You will also work closely with DCW Project Managers to incorporate client feedback effectively and ensure a seamless client experience.

Your role will involve regular communication across multiple departments to plan execution and obtain internal approvals, including from legal, S&P, BA, and the current series teams. Additionally, you will collaborate closely with the ad sales team to provide information about sellable opportunities.

Responsibilities:

  • Facilitate all phases of production for DCW turn-key branded content campaigns to be distributed across streaming, social, digital, and linear.

  • Oversee outside vendors in executing projects.

  • Align with Project Management to create necessary calendars and production schedules for the Sales team, clients and vendors.

  • Liaise with creative marketing teams to secure internal toolkits and other assets

  • Respond efficiently to requests and look for ways to streamline processes to make turn-key custom asset production as seamless as possible, driving additional revenue opportunities

  • Facilitate the internal approval process across brand marketing, S&P, legal, etc.

  • Maintain updates and communication with the CreativeWorks teams on calendars, assets, etc. leveraging project management software (e.g. Airtable)

  • Deal directly with vendors as needed on payment schedules

  • Work closely with the creative team in the development and approval of custom content and franchises in support of DAS/client solutions.

Qualifications:

  • 3+ years' related experience in a production or post production environment

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ills. 

  • Excellent collaborative skills to work with multiple departments on both coasts and internationally.

  • Excellent mathematical and reasoning skills to manage multiple budgets and timelines for internal and external stakeholders, including vendors and clients.

  • Mac OS, Microsoft Office, strong knowledge of production and post-production processes and familiarity with project management software (AirTable).

Education:

Bachelors degree in related field of study or equivalent work experience


The hiring range for this position in New York, NY is $80,000.00 to $129,800.00 per year and in Burbank, CA is $76,300.00 to $104,800.00 per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ate’s ge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A bonus and/or long-term incentive units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to the full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its, dependent on the level and position offered.
